Biography
Ziyuan Li is a fourth-year PhD candidate in Marketing at the University of Connecticut. Her research leverages machine learning, Large Language Models (LLMs), and causal inference to understand consumer dynamics on digital platforms. In particular, she uses transformer-based models with LLM prompting to improve interpretability and enhance marketers’ ability to make data-driven decisions. Using large-scale platform data and field experiments, she studies how platform design shapes engagement and demand.
